Introduction 1. The Political Landscape of Asylum in Britain 2. Rendered Vulnerable by the State: Structural Violence in the Asylum System 3. Compounding Trauma: Impacts of the Asylum System on Survivors of Torture, Sexual Torture and Sexual Abuse 4.
